Este artículo presenta principalmente las precauciones para usar y y o en la declaración SQL de asp. Los amigos que lo necesiten pueden consultarlo.
Al depurar el programa hoy, necesitamos usar y o si no dominamos las habilidades, la estructura de salida es un poco diferente de lo que imaginamos. Espero que todos admitan Script Home en el futuro.
¿Se pueden usar y o no al mismo tiempo en declaraciones SQL ASP?
La respuesta es sí, aquí te explicamos cómo hacerlo:
1. Soy muy responsable de decirte que se pueden utilizar al mismo tiempo. Pero depende de los requisitos del negocio.
2. Ejemplos de escenarios de uso:
Compañeros varones nacidos en 2000 y 2002 en la tabla de consulta.
seleccione * de la tabla de estudiantes donde género='masculino' y (año de nacimiento=2000 o año de nacimiento=2002)
3. De hecho, o puede reemplazarse por In en SQL, que será más conveniente de escribir.
Por ejemplo, el ejemplo anterior está escrito usando In:
seleccione * de la tabla de estudiantes donde género = 'masculino' y año de nacimiento (2000,2002)
De hecho, se utiliza () para ampliar las áreas que necesitan atención.
Por ejemplo: la búsqueda en segundo plano de Script House debe determinar cuándo la búsqueda es js. Luego, algunos de nuestros editores usan javascript, por lo que algunas cosas no se pueden buscar. Entonces puede consultar este método.
Código central:
seleccione case lcase(keyarr(I)) case js sqlk=sqlk& y (título como '%&keyarr(I)&%' o título como '%javascript%') case javascript sqlk=sqlk& y (título como '%&keyarr(I) )&%' o título como '%js%') caso c# sqlk=sqlk& y (título como '%&keyarr(I)&%' o título como '%csharp%') caso csharp sqlk=sqlk& y (título como '%&keyarr(I)&%' o título como '%c#%') caso más sqlk=sqlk& y título como '%&keyarr(I) &%' final de selección